How to Bill for Your Time Honestly
By Karl Kniseley·3 min read·Updated June 2026
The honesty problem with billing time is usually the opposite of what people fear. Freelancers routinely forget the emails, the calls, the thinking, the small fixes, and bill only the obvious hours. Honest billing means counting the real work, not shaving it out of guilt.
Track as you go, not from memory
Reconstructing your week from memory always loses hours. Track time as you work, even roughly, so the invoice reflects reality. If hourly keeps costing you for being fast, that is a sign to move toward flat-rate pricing for the result instead.
